The CRM Group aims to increase its contribution to the industrial and societal challenges of greenhouse gas mitigation and resource efficiency, with a focus on energy transition and in particular on topics such as waste recovery, biomass, CCUS (carbon capture, utilisation or storage), hydrogen and energy storage. These subjects are at the heart of the R&D projects carried out by the Energy & Low Impact Industry unit and are linked internally to several other units and activities through its « Energy Shift » technology platform.
